Character Overview

Playstyles

Shielder (Shieldbot)

By far the most recommended playstyle for using Zhongli. A shield-focused build wants to maximize his HP to maintain the shield. Zhongli is the best pure shielder in the game due to his shield’s strength and uptime.


This Zhongli guide does not cover the following playstyles in-depth. Please refer to our Zhongli Extended Guide for more information.

Burst Support

In most situations, it is not recommended to use Zhongli’s Burst because of its long animation and low damage output. However, at C2 or with very high investment, Zhongli can become a viable Burst support in addition to his general shielder playstyle.

Physical DPS (Pikeli)

Physical DPS Zhongli possesses underwhelming personal damage, dealing similar DPS to Eula in single-target scenarios. Pikeli can be viable if Zhongli acts as a driver for strong teammates or has a high-investment build against a single enemy.

Hybrid DPS (Hybridli)

Hybrid DPS Zhongli is a variant of Physical DPS Zhongli that trades some of his Physical DMG for some AoE Geo DMG. While being able to offer more AoE DMG than Pikeli, it still possesses underwhelming personal damage and requires rather high investments. Hybridli is a build only recommended for players who want to make use of the entirety of his kit.

Geo Construct DPS (Microwave)

Zhongli can use his Stone Stele resonance to deal AoE damage in conjunction with Geo Traveler’s Geo Constructs. While Traveler is the most common and recommended teammate, other Geo characters like Albedo and Ningguang place Geo Constructs that resonate with Zhongli’s Stele. 

This playstyle also requires you to know how to position Geo Constructs accurately and struggles against highly mobile enemies or bosses who can destroy the constructs.

Talents

Level and Talent Priority

Talent Priority
Elemental Skill

In Zhongli’s recommended playstyle as a pure shielder, he only needs to level his Elemental Skill. Leveling him to 90 maximizes his effective shield HP, but this is a lower priority after reaching 80/90. 

Other playstyle Talent priorities:

  • Burst Support: Level his Burst equally to his Skill.
  • Physical DPS: Prioritize his Normal Attack Talent.

Talent Overview

Normal Attack
Normal Attack | Rain of Stone

Normal Attack
Performs up to 6 consecutive spear strikes.

Charged Attack
Consumes a certain amount of Stamina to lunge forward, causing stone spears to fall along his path.

Plunging Attack
Plunges from mid-air to strike the ground below, damaging opponents along the path and dealing AoE DMG upon impact.

Zhongli’s Normal Attacks are among the fastest in the game. This, along with the multi-hit on his N5, makes him a good driver and excellent user of Crescent Pike in a Physical DPS playstyle. His Normal Attacks also allow many chances to land a CRIT Hit and trigger Favonius Lance’s passive.

Elemental Skill
zhongli elemental skill Elemental Skill | Dominus Lapidis

Press
Commands the power of earth to create a Stone Stele.

Hold
Causes nearby Geo energy to explode, causing the following effects:

  • If their maximum number hasn’t been reached, creates a Stone Stele.
  • Creates a shield of jade. The shield’s DMG Absorption scales based on Zhongli’s Max HP.
  • Deals AoE Geo DMG.
  • If there are nearby targets with the Geo Element, it will drain a large amount of Geo Element from a maximum of 2 such targets. This effect does not cause DMG.

Stone Stele
When created, deals AoE Geo DMG. Additionally, it will intermittently resonate with other nearby Geo constructs, dealing Geo DMG to surrounding opponents. The Stone Stele is considered a Geo construct that can both be climbed and used to block attacks.

Only one Stele created by Zhongli himself may initially exist at any one time.

Jade Shield
Possesses 150% DMG Absorption against all Elemental and Physical DMG. Characters protected by the Jade Shield will decrease the Elemental RES and Physical RES of opponents in a small AoE by 20%. This effect cannot be stacked.

Zhongli’s most significant Talent is his Elemental Skill. When the Skill is tapped or held, Zhongli places a Stone Stele in front of him, which deals regular ticks of AoE Geo damage. The AoE effect resonates with other Geo Constructs in range, which allows for more instances of damage.

When the Skill is held, Zhongli deals Geo damage, generates a Jade Shield, and produces a Stone Stele if there isn’t one already (up to two at C1). This shield shreds the Elemental and Physical RES of enemies close to the on-field character. This is usually referred to as Universal RES Shred. 

The Stone Stele’s particle generation is unreliable since each tick only has a 50% chance to generate a particle, and it is difficult to keep enemies within its AoE in practice. Furthermore, some enemies (notably bosses) easily destroy the Stele.

Elemental Burst
Elemental Burst | Planet Befall

Brings a falling meteor down to earth, dealing massive Geo DMG to opponents caught in its AoE and applying the Petrification status to them.

Petrification
Opponents affected by the Petrification status cannot move.

Zhongli’s Elemental Burst possesses a long animation that often results in a DPS loss. Nonetheless, his Elemental Burst can be used to petrify enemies and dodge attacks (since you are invulnerable to damage during its animation).

Ascension 1 Passive
Ascension 1 Passive | Resonant Waves

When the Jade Shield takes DMG, it will Fortify:

  • Fortified characters have 5% increased Shield Strength.
  • Can stack up to 5 times, and lasts until the Jade Shield disappears.

This A1 Passive increases the active character’s Shield Strength when the Jade Shield takes damage. The stacks on this passive persist between character swaps, but they are reset if the shield is refreshed.

Ascension 4 Passive
Ascension 4 Passive | Dominance of Earth

Zhongli deals bonus DMG based on his Max HP:

  • Normal Attack, Charged Attack, and Plunging Attack DMG is increased by 1.39% of Max HP.
  • Dominus Lapidis’ Stone Stele, resonance, and hold DMG is increased by 1.9% of Max HP.
  • Planet Befall’s DMG is increased by 33% of Max HP.

This A4 Passive increases Zhongli’s personal damage based on his Max HP; however, ATK stats are still more valuable than HP stats for DPS-focused builds. This holds true even with considerable Flat ATK buffs from teammates or if Zhongli holds Staff of Homa.

Constellations

Constellation 1
Constellation 1 | Rock, the Backbone of Earth

Increases the maximum number of Stone Steles created by Dominus Lapidis that may exist simultaneously to 2.

Zhongli’s first Constellation lets him place up to two Stone Steles on the field; however, his Skill cooldown does not change and there are not multiple charges.

While this Constellation doesn’t double the amount of particles the Stele generates, it does increase the likelihood of generating particles as an additional Stele increases the chances of hitting opponents, indirectly improving Zhongli’s energy regeneration.

Constellation 2
Constellation 2 | Stone, the Cradle of Jade

Planet Befall grants nearby characters on the field a Jade Shield when it descends.

This Constellation lets Zhongli summon a Jade Shield with his Burst. At C2, Zhongli’s Burst also summons shields for allies in Co-Op.

Constellation 3
Constellation 3 | Jade, Shimmering through Darkness

Increases the Level of Dominus Lapidis by 3.
Maximum upgrade level is 15.

Increases Zhongli’s effective shield HP and Skill damage.

Constellation 4
Constellation 4 | Topaz, Unbreakable and Fearless

Increases Planet Befall’s AoE by 20% and increases the duration of Planet Befall’s Petrification effect by 2s.

A quality-of-life upgrade. This gives Zhongli’s Burst slightly more value since enemies are petrified for 2s longer.

Constellation 5
Constellation 5 | Lazuli, Herald of the Order

Increases the Level of Planet Befall by 3.
Maximum upgrade level is 15.

Increases Zhongli’s Burst damage.

Constellation 6
Constellation 6 | Chrysos, Bounty of Dominator

When the Jade Shield takes DMG, 40% of that incoming DMG is converted to HP for the current character. A single instance of regeneration cannot exceed 8% of that character’s Max HP.

Zhongli’s final Constellation is rather redundant since his shield is enough to avoid taking damage in most circumstances. Against Corrosion, however, his C6 becomes more helpful.

This final Constellation can increase Zhongli’s viability with units that hold 4pc Marechausee Hunter (like Lyney) since these DPS units often inflict self-damage that they can heal back with Zhongli’s C6 effect if necessary. However, this healing is antagonistic to Hu Tao since it can deactivate her A4 passive.

Artifacts

ER Requirements

Zhongli does not use his Burst in his common shielder playstyle. Refer to these ER requirements for a Burst support build only.

Burst Every Other Rotation100–110%
Burst Every Rotation (1 Other Geo)120-140%
Burst Every Rotation (No Other Geo)175-220%

Use the Energy Recharge Calculator to determine exact requirements for your team and rotation.

Artifact Stats

The following stat priorities are for a shielder playstyle. It is not worth investing into pure shielder Zhongli’s personal damage when you can put those resources towards your team’s DPS units.


Sands

Goblet

Circlet
HP%HP%HP% or CRIT Rate

Substats: HP% ≥ Flat HP > CRIT Rate (if using Favonius Lance)

CRIT Rate is only necessary when using Favonius Lance. If you weave in a few Normal Attacks, you only need about 30% CRIT Rate at R5 to proc it 75% of the time.

Artifact Sets

This section focuses on maximizing Zhongli’s support utility. For DPS artifact sets, see the Zhongli Extended Guide.


Rainbow
Any artifacts that provide the most HP stats for Zhongli work well enough since he doesn’t rely on set effects in his kit.

2pc HP% + 2pc HP%
Provides the strongest shield for Zhongli in terms of effective HP. However, one set is not available via Strongbox which can make farming for it less efficient than just going for a rainbow set.

4pc Tenacity of the Millelith
While Zhongli may seem like an ideal user of this set, his Stele’s limited range prevents him from using this set effectively in a lot of circumstances. However, if your team’s DPS unit can snapshot the 4pc ATK% buff, then it can be viable since Zhongli still procs the effect by using his Hold Skill.

4pc Archaic Petra
Zhongli has to personally pick up the most recently created Elemental Shard to trigger 4pc Archaic Petra’s set bonus. This can be difficult to accommodate in practice without increasing rotation time. Despite this, the buff does apply to every teammate when you can activate it. 
Deepwood Memories
4pc Deepwood Memories
Zhongli can use this set in Dendro teams since his Hold Skill and Stele can trigger the 4pc set effect. The 8s uptime on the buff is more forgiving; however, maintaining 100% uptime can be difficult given the Stele’s limited range. 

4pc Instructor
This is a niche set that only benefits specific teams. It often requires altered rotations that make it not worth the hassle in most cases.

Weapons


Favonius Lance
Favonius Lance increases Zhongli’s utility by providing the team with particles which lower ER requirements. The passive does not proc off-field and you need to build some CRIT Rate to trigger it more consistently.

Black Tassel
This 3-star Polearm provides the highest HP% secondary stat among Polearms and is easy to obtain. It is Zhongli’s best option for maximum shield health.

Shielder

Zhongli is extremely versatile as the best shielder in the game. The Universal RES Shred from his shield allows him to be useful in a variety of teams. Some DPS characters really need a shield for resistance to interruption like Hu Tao, Lyney, Xiao, Yoimiya, and Wanderer.

Compared to a 4pc Viridescent Venerer user, Zhongli is about 10% worse in terms of damage gains for relevant Elemental DPS characters, but his shield may make him more valuable if you lack an appropriate healer and need the survivability.

Example Teams

This is not a comprehensive list of teams. The inclusion or exclusion of any given team does not necessarily reflect its power level.

Zhongli — Hu TaoXingqiuYelan

This Hu Tao team deals significant single-target damage. Hu Tao enjoys Zhongli’s shield due to her HP reduction after using her Skill. This team’s rotation can allow either one or two uses of Yelan’s Skill.

Sample Rotation
Xingqiu Q E (catch particles) > Zhongli hE > Yelan Q E (catch particles) > Hu Tao combo

Alternatively, you can cast Zhongli’s Hold Skill right before Hu Tao’s combo to provide the highest 4pc Instructor uptime for Hu Tao. Zhongli can also hold 4pc Petra to buff Xingqiu and Yelan, in which case he should go on-field after one of the Hydro characters to generate and pick up a Shard. 

For more rotation variations, see the Hu Tao Extended Guide.

Zhongli — IttoAlbedoGorou

A classic Mono Geo team. Itto appreciates Zhongli’s shield for the consistent Geo Resonance buff, Geo RES Shred, and defensive utility,

Sample Rotation
Zhongli hE > Gorou EQ > Albedo E > Itto combo

Zhongli — XiaoFaruzanBennett

Xiao enjoys a strong shielder to avoid getting staggered, which makes Zhongli a premier option. The Anemo RES Shred provided by Zhongli’s shield also boosts Xiao’s damage. Faruzan should be C6 since it lowers her ER requirements and buffs Xiao’s damage considerably.

Sample Rotation
Zhongli hE > Faruzan EQ > Bennett EQ > Xiao 2[E] Q combo > Bennett E

Zhongli — LyneyKazuhaBennett

As a Charged Shot DPS, Lyney requires interruption resistance to avoid being staggered out of his charging animation. In this team specifically, using Kazuha’s Burst is a DPS loss in single-target scenarios; skipping the Burst allows Lyney to fit one more Charged Shot in the rotation.

Sample Rotation
Zhongli hE > Bennett EQ > Kazuha tEP > Lyney 5[C] (Q/C) E

Lyney should use his Burst every other rotation. When his Burst is down, he can use a sixth Charged Shot before casting his Skill.
